According to latest report, it has come to light that the Project Affected People (PAP) have decided to stage agitation on June 24 to put pressure on the Maharashtra government to name the proposed Navi Mumbai International Airport (NMIA) after late socialist D B Patil.

It is the death anniversary of the late socialist Patil on June 24, therefore, this date has been selected for the protest that will be carried out by the PAP of 27 villages of Navi Mumbai under the banner of the All-Party Action Committee (APNC). 

This decision was taken by them during a meeting held on Wednesday, May 18. They claimed that it was a long pending demand and the state government is ignoring it.

Reports stated that more than one lakh farmers are expected to join the protest from Thane, Palghar, Raigad, and Mumbai. A plan of forming a human chain is underway. However, a decision has not been taken yet.

For those unversed, since the last two years, PAPs of Navi Mumbai under the banner of the All-Party Action Committee (APAC) have been protesting against the state government and CIDCO for not giving the name of NMIA after Patil, who is also a PAPs leader.
